Output 768b953613da9c18fb411d7a86d3f65f9779ae296b1de8e1680a1628d1e67b0c:0

value
600000
script pubkey
OP_0 OP_PUSHBYTES_20 c18f89c172d2e449e97263ec1f6f477ee44b681e
address
bc1qcx8cnstj6tjyn6tjv0kp7m680mjyk6q7haz5ka
transaction
768b953613da9c18fb411d7a86d3f65f9779ae296b1de8e1680a1628d1e67b0c